摘要随着京东业务的高速增长,作为应用入口的负载均衡,大流量大并发带来的挑战越来越严峻。本文主要介绍了京东商城设计和实践的一套高可靠,高性能的负载均衡器,我们命名为SKYLB。是一个使用intel DPDK报文转发库,实现运行在通用X86服务器上自研的分布式负载均衡服务。配合网络路由器的OSPF或者BGP协议,组成承担京东数据中心核心四层负载均衡的集群。最大限度的发挥普通X86服务器硬件资源的性能,
作者【美】Randy Zhang , Micah Bartell2.2 BGP进程和内存使用BGP设计与实现Cisco IOS软件有3种主要的BGP进程:输入输出(I/O);路由器(Router);扫描仪(Scanner)。图2-1显示了3种BGP进程以及在IOS中所有主要的BGP组件之间的相互作用。BGP I/O进程处理读、写和执行BGP消息的任务。它为TCP和BGP之间提供了一个接口。一方面,
集成产品开发(Integrated Product Development, 简称IPD)是一套产品开发的模式、理念与方法。IPD的思想来源于美国PRTM公司出版的《产品及生命周期优化法一书,该书中详细描述了这种新的产品开发模式所包含的各个方面。最先将IPD付诸实践的是IBM公司,IBM公司实施IPD的效果不管在财务指标还是质量指标上得到验证,最显著的改进在于:  1、 产品研发周期显著缩短;  
通过两张图形,即可对IPD体系的顶层设计有一个基本的了解,获得齐全的产出团队设置、大致的团队内运作和团队间协同。IPD概念模型——再提“四四四”模型第一张是研发管理的“四四四”模型,可参考之前的笔记《IPD——从战略到执行的全面研发管理体系》,介绍了IPD的总体架构,四大产出团队、四大产出流程、四大支撑体系。 研发的运作首先要划分职能,确定好都需要做哪些事儿,把这些事儿从最顶层做个切割,
上一篇blog可谓IPD最为核心的部分,也就是IPD的主要流程,在上篇博客中我详细介绍了IPD的各个核心阶段以及每个核心阶段的细致流程、参与人员、每个人的具体职责,那么相信大家对整体的流程以及流程对IPD理念的实践和要解决什么问题都比较清楚了,新的研发流程下和旧的相比就有很多的优势: 本篇博客介绍IPD的主要模块,也就是涉及到的一些模板: 其中比较核心的是:项目计划(管理)、PRD、技术架构和一页
# IPD组织架构及其在软件开发中的应用 ## 引言 在软件开发中,良好的组织架构是保证项目顺利进行和高效协作的关键因素之一。IPD(Iterative and Incremental Development)组织架构是一种流行的敏捷开发方法,它以迭代和逐步增量的方式推进项目,并倡导团队成员间的紧密合作和有效沟通。本文将介绍IPD组织架构的基本原理和各个角色的职责,并通过代码示例展示IPD在软
原创 2023-09-17 05:02:26
279阅读
概念集成产品开发(Integrated Product Development, 简称IPD)是一套产品开发的模式、理念与方法。IPD的思想来源于美国PRTM公司出版的《产品及生命周期优化法》IPD分为的阶段各个名词解释:CHATER:业务计划书,包括项目范围、目标、验收标准等 CDCP:概念决策评审点 PDCP:计划决策评审点 ADCP:可获得性决策评审点 在软件开发过程中一共有6个TR点,对应
# IPD技术预研组织架构实现指南 ## 流程 首先,让我们通过一个表格展示实现“IPD技术预研组织架构”的步骤: | 步骤 | 描述 | | --- | --- | | 1 | 创建项目结构 | | 2 | 设计数据库表 | | 3 | 实现基本功能 | | 4 | 添加权限管理功能 | | 5 | 部署和测试 | ## 具体步骤 ### 1. 创建项目结构 首先,我们需要创建一个新
TPM特点全效率:设备寿命周期费用评价和设备综合效率。全系统:指生产维修系统的各个方法都要包括在内。即是PM、MP、CM、 BM等都要包含。全员参与:指设备的计划、使用、维修等所有部门都要参加,尤其注重的是操作 者的自主小组活动。TPM目标零停机零废品零安全事故零速度损失设备点检点检制定义:点检制是以点检为中心的设备维修管理体制,点检制的医学内涵就象人要做身体检查一样,利用一些检查手段,对设备进行
集成产品开发(IPD)初探51CMM.COM原创 作者:田俊国 [2003/03/12]    一、 IPD背景    集成产品开发(Integrated Product Development, 简称IPD)是一套产品开发的模式、理念与方法。IPD的思想来源于美国PRTM公司出版的《产品及生命周期优化法》(简称PAC
IPD
原创 3月前
0阅读
# 如何实现IPD流程架构 ## 流程图示意 ```mermaid flowchart TD Start --> Analysis Analysis --> Design Design --> Implementation Implementation --> Testing Testing --> Deployment Deployment -
系统将采用多层次的架构设计,采用MVC的设计模式,支持XML接口和ajax的动态接口,建立复杂的状态流。多层架构的出现,使得程序编写的代码得以重用,程序员之间可以更好地分工合作,程序架构更加清晰并易于维护。多层架构适用于需要协同开发且具有一定规模或业务较复杂的系统。同时由于分了多层,一个接口的变化可能会引起多层接口的修改。多层设计结构架构同“软件架构”定义,是一系列相关的抽象模式,用于指导大型软件
转载 2023-08-04 10:47:29
62阅读
软件型企业通常也会有自己的IPD流程,IPD是产品从0到1的研发整体流程。在IPD中,由于涉及到的流程多,参与的人员多,如果没有一个在线工具支撑,那么很容易陷入混乱。传统管理中,PM通过excel将IPD中的每个流程节点管理起来,但是excel的分享和记录变化能力很差,要看过程的变化很难,也缺少协作。如果有在线的项目管理工具,我们看看IPD可以怎么开始推进?我们选取了Tita的项目管理,来向大家展
迈普是2003年引入IPD的,我当时受过一点点培训。也亲身参与其中,有一点感觉,这里抛块砖。  感觉IPD有其优点,矩阵式架构,能在产品的每个决策点,找到对应的角色为其负责,并且对于产品市场化的推动效果非常明显。  不足之处是IPD各项考评太过于量化,这对于预研性质的研发影响很大,很多预研项目,由于没有市场支撑,最终无法统计工作量。  而IT企业,能固守已
转载 2023-09-04 23:32:53
83阅读
01IPD解读什么是IPDIPD是一套产品及研发管理的体系,是从产品投资与开发的角度来审视产品与研发管理的思想和架构。通过构建优秀的管理体系来达到提升产品管理与研发绩效的目的。IPD涵盖了产品从概念到生命周期结束全过程的管理,而这一过程正是技术创新的过程。因此,通过实施IPD从而提高产品开发的效率和成功率,降低成本,提高企业效益,能够达到提升产品开发能力的作用,同时也达到了提高企业自主创新能力的
集成产品开发(Integrated Product Development, 简称IPD)是一套产品开发的模式、理念与方法。源于美国PRTM公司出版的《产品及生命周期优化法》一书。最具有代表实践者有IBM和华为。IPD 架构与核心内容1、产品开发是一项投资 2、必须强调基于市场的创新 3、执行技术开发与产品开发分离 4、强调对技术进行分类管理,强调核心技术,关键技术的自主开发一,般技术、通用技术合
康威定律在设计系统时,组织所交付的方案结构将不可避免地与其沟通结构一致。 协作问题根据康威定律,技术架构组织的职责划分相关,而职责划分从根本上确立了组织的沟通协作方式,这种协作方式最终决定了技术架构的形态。如果你的组织本身是比较松散的协作方式,往往你的架构会变得离散;而如果你的组织是紧耦合的,架构往往也会慢慢向紧耦合的方式发展。当技术人员将单体应用拆分成多个细粒度服务的时候,就产生了服
流程图可能是我们使用最广泛的一种图形图表,几乎在各个领域都会用到,诸如系统流程图、产品流程图、数据流程图……借助流程图,我们可以将事物的结构、任务的进程、甚至是算法的思路都有效视觉化。流程图的广泛应用,也直接催生出不少绘图软件,但由于开发者的不同,这些软件在能力上存在或多或少的差异。那我们究竟该怎么挑选一款适合自己的流程图软件?答案尽在本篇综合测评中。01 亿图图示准确来说,亿图图示是一款综合类办
[size=medium][color=blue] 关于组织架构也是一个非常重要的概念。为什么说组织架构是一个非常重要概念呢,现在大家应该常常听说上市公司的公司治理。里面就有组织架构设计。通俗时候,组织架构设计是根据企业的发展战略,对集团、公司,部门岗位,人员设置及其想考核体系而设计的。这样的组织架构更具有针对性,能够更好的适应业务流程和更好的促进企
  • 1
  • 2
  • 3
  • 4
  • 5